So you hold down +, and while holding down plus, press T, and then + stops bein pressed?
That's pretty normal, AFAIK. How the keyboard operates. Try it in a word processor. You'll see the same result. At 04:08 PM 12/14/2006, you wrote: >Hi there, > >How do I prevent the following from happening with the keyboard, >while flying manually with fg... > >- Keyboard repeat is same as in my text editor; I want it to be > linear, with no delay after keypress >- If I'm holding down a key to adjust something like the throttle, > when I press other keys the throttle will stop moving, requiring > me to release then press its key again. As you can imagine that > can get really tricky, with spoilers, reversors, and rudder all > needing input during tricky crosswind landings...as I hit the > key to adjust throttle again that might kill the key for the > rudder if I'm holding that down... > >The usual end result is a 777 off the side of the runway, and me >throwing choice language at the keyboard as I hurtle to my (virtual) >death... :-) > >I'm running 0.9.10 stable on SUSE 10.1, with freeglut-051110-15 >(I think that came from cvs over a year ago).
